Hi,

As Kai Qiang mentioned, magnum gate recently had a bunch of random failures, 
which occurred on creating a nova instance with 2G of RAM. According to the 
error message, it seems that the hypervisor tried to allocate memory to the 
nova instance but couldn’t find enough free memory in the host. However, by 
adding a few “nova hypervisor-show XX” before, during, and right after the 
test, it showed that the host has 6G of free RAM, which is far more than 2G. 
Here is a snapshot of the output [1]. You can find the full log here [2].

Another observation is that most of the failure happened on a node with name 
“devstack-trusty-ovh-*” (You can verify it by entering a query [3] at 
http://logstash.openstack.org/ ). It seems that the jobs will be fine if they 
are allocated to a node other than “ovh”.

Any hints to debug this issue further? Suggestions are greatly appreciated.

[1] http://paste.openstack.org/show/481746/
[2] 
http://logs.openstack.org/48/256748/1/check/gate-functional-dsvm-magnum-swarm/56d79c3/console.html
[3] https://review.openstack.org/#/c/254370/2/queries/1521237.yaml

Best regards,
Hongbin

From: Kai Qiang Wu [mailto:wk...@cn.ibm.com]
Sent: December-09-15 7:23 AM
To: openstack-dev@lists.openstack.org
Subject: [openstack-dev] [Infra][nova][magnum] Jenkins failed quite often for 
"Cannot set up guest memory 'pc.ram': Cannot allocate memory"


Hi All,

I am not sure what changes these days, We found quite often now, the Jenkins 
failed for:


http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z

2015-12-09 
08:52:27.892<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_27_892>+0000:
 22957: debug : qemuMonitorJSONCommandWithFd:264 : Send command 
'{"execute":"qmp_capabilities","id":"libvirt-1"}' for write with FD -1
2015-12-09 
08:52:27.892<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_27_892>+0000:
 22957: debug : qemuMonitorSend:959 : QEMU_MONITOR_SEND_MSG: mon=0x7fa66400c6f0 
msg={"execute":"qmp_capabilities","id":"libvirt-1"}
 fd=-1
2015-12-09 
08:52:27.941<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_27_941>+0000:
 22951: debug : virNetlinkEventCallback:347 : dispatching to max 0 clients, 
called from event watch 6
2015-12-09 
08:52:27.941<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_27_941>+0000:
 22951: debug : virNetlinkEventCallback:360 : event not handled.
2015-12-09 
08:52:27.941<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_27_941>+0000:
 22951: debug : virNetlinkEventCallback:347 : dispatching to max 0 clients, 
called from event watch 6
2015-12-09 
08:52:27.941<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_27_941>+0000:
 22951: debug : virNetlinkEventCallback:360 : event not handled.
2015-12-09 
08:52:27.941<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_27_941>+0000:
 22951: debug : virNetlinkEventCallback:347 : dispatching to max 0 clients, 
called from event watch 6
2015-12-09 
08:52:27.941<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_27_941>+0000:
 22951: debug : virNetlinkEventCallback:360 : event not handled.
2015-12-09 
08:52:28.070<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_28_070>+0000:
 22951: error : qemuMonitorIORead:554 : Unable to read from monitor: Connection 
reset by peer
2015-12-09 
08:52:28.070<http://logs.openstack.org/07/244907/5/check/gate-functional-dsvm-magnum-k8s/5305d7a/logs/libvirt/libvirtd.txt.gz#_2015-12-09_08_52_28_070>+0000:
 22951: error : qemuMonitorIO:690 : internal error: early end of file from 
monitor: possible problem:
Cannot set up guest memory 'pc.ram': Cannot allocate memory




It not hit such resource issue before. I am not sure if Infra or nova guys know 
about it ?


Thanks

Best Wishes,
--------------------------------------------------------------------------------
Kai Qiang Wu (吴开强 Kennan)
IBM China System and Technology Lab, Beijing

E-mail: wk...@cn.ibm.com<mailto:wk...@cn.ibm.com>
Tel: 86-10-82451647
Address: Building 28(Ring Building), ZhongGuanCun Software Park,
No.8 Dong Bei Wang West Road, Haidian District Beijing P.R.China 100193
--------------------------------------------------------------------------------
Follow your heart. You are miracle!
__________________________________________________________________________
OpenStack Development Mailing List (not for usage questions)
Unsubscribe: openstack-dev-requ...@lists.openstack.org?subject:unsubscribe
http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-dev

Reply via email to